About

Masahide Kikkawa is a scholar working on Molecular Biology, Cell Biology and Structural Biology. According to data from OpenAlex, Masahide Kikkawa has authored 77 papers receiving a total of 3.6k indexed citations (citations by other indexed papers that have themselves been cited), including 51 papers in Molecular Biology, 43 papers in Cell Biology and 14 papers in Structural Biology. Recurrent topics in Masahide Kikkawa’s work include Microtubule and mitosis dynamics (37 papers), Photosynthetic Processes and Mechanisms (17 papers) and Protist diversity and phylogeny (14 papers). Masahide Kikkawa is often cited by papers focused on Microtubule and mitosis dynamics (37 papers), Photosynthetic Processes and Mechanisms (17 papers) and Protist diversity and phylogeny (14 papers). Masahide Kikkawa collaborates with scholars based in Japan, United States and China. Masahide Kikkawa's co-authors include Nobutaka Hirokawa, Haruaki Yanagisawa, Toshiyuki Oda, Yasushi Okada, Radostin Danev, Hiroaki Yajima, Akihisa Tsutsumi, Takao Nakata, Ryo Nitta and Elena P. Sablin and has published in prestigious journals such as Nature, Science and Cell.
